函式
函式 | 說明 |
---|---|
onPlanAutomatedUpdatePublished(處理常式) | 宣告可處理自動計費方案更新事件的函式。 |
onPlanAutomaticUpdatePublished(選擇、處理常式) | 宣告可處理自動計費方案更新事件的函式。 |
onPlanUpdatePublished(處理常式) | 宣告可處理計費方案更新事件的函式。 |
onPlanUpdatePublished(選擇, 處理常式) | 宣告可處理計費方案更新事件的函式。 |
介面
介面 | 說明 |
---|---|
BillingEvent | 用來計費 Firebase 快訊的自訂 CloudEvent (包含自訂擴充功能屬性)。 |
PlanAutomaticUpdatePayload | 計費方案自動更新的內部酬載物件。酬載包裝在 FirebaseAlertData 物件中。 |
PlanUpdatePayload | 計費方案更新的內部酬載物件。酬載包裝在 FirebaseAlertData 物件中。 |
alert.billing.onPlanAutomatedUpdatePublished()
宣告可處理自動計費方案更新事件的函式。
簽名:
export declare function onPlanAutomatedUpdatePublished(handler: (event: BillingEvent<PlanAutomatedUpdatePayload>) => any | Promise<any>): CloudFunction<BillingEvent<PlanAutomatedUpdatePayload>>;
參數
參數 | 類型 | 說明 |
---|---|---|
handler | (事件:BillingEvent<PlanAutomatedUpdatePayload>) =>不限 |承諾<任何> | 每次發生自動計費方案更新時,都會執行的事件處理常式。 |
傳回:
CloudFunction<BillingEvent<PlanAutomatedUpdatePayload>>
可匯出及部署的函式。
alert.billing.onPlanAutomatedUpdatePublished()
宣告可處理自動計費方案更新事件的函式。
簽名:
export declare function onPlanAutomatedUpdatePublished(opts: options.EventHandlerOptions, handler: (event: BillingEvent<PlanAutomatedUpdatePayload>) => any | Promise<any>): CloudFunction<BillingEvent<PlanAutomatedUpdatePayload>>;
參數
參數 | 類型 | 說明 |
---|---|---|
最佳化 | options.EventHandlerOptions | 可對函式設定的選項。 |
handler | (事件:BillingEvent<PlanAutomatedUpdatePayload>) =>不限 |承諾<任何> | 每次發生自動計費方案更新時,都會執行的事件處理常式。 |
傳回:
CloudFunction<BillingEvent<PlanAutomatedUpdatePayload>>
可匯出及部署的函式。
alert.billing.onPlanUpdatePublished()
宣告可處理計費方案更新事件的函式。
簽名:
export declare function onPlanUpdatePublished(handler: (event: BillingEvent<PlanUpdatePayload>) => any | Promise<any>): CloudFunction<BillingEvent<PlanUpdatePayload>>;
參數
參數 | 類型 | 說明 |
---|---|---|
handler | (事件:BillingEvent<PlanUpdatePayload>) =>不限 |承諾<任何> | 每次更新計費方案時都會執行的事件處理常式。 |
傳回:
CloudFunction<BillingEvent<PlanUpdatePayload>>
可匯出及部署的函式。
alert.billing.onPlanUpdatePublished()
宣告可處理計費方案更新事件的函式。
簽名:
export declare function onPlanUpdatePublished(opts: options.EventHandlerOptions, handler: (event: BillingEvent<PlanUpdatePayload>) => any | Promise<any>): CloudFunction<BillingEvent<PlanUpdatePayload>>;
參數
參數 | 類型 | 說明 |
---|---|---|
最佳化 | options.EventHandlerOptions | 可對函式設定的選項。 |
handler | (事件:BillingEvent<PlanUpdatePayload>) =>不限 |承諾<任何> | 每次更新計費方案時都會執行的事件處理常式。 |
傳回:
CloudFunction<BillingEvent<PlanUpdatePayload>>
可匯出及部署的函式。